在现代软件开发中,GitHub 已成为一个不可或缺的工具。无论是开源项目还是个人项目,很多开发者都希望能够_分享文件夹_,以便其他人可以访问、使用或者贡献代码。本文将详细探讨如何在GitHub上有效分享文件夹,包括步骤、注意事项以及常见问题解答。
目录
什么是GitHub分享文件夹
在GitHub上,分享文件夹意味着将代码或项目的某个特定部分通过公共或私人链接共享给其他用户。这可以通过多个方式实现,主要依赖于GitHub的强大功能。
GitHub的特点
- 版本控制:GitHub提供了强大的版本控制功能,使得多用户可以在同一项目中协作。
- 开源共享:用户可以选择将项目设为公开,以便全世界的开发者都可以查看和贡献。
- 团队协作:支持多人协作,使得项目管理更加高效。
如何在GitHub上创建文件夹
在分享文件夹之前,您需要知道如何在GitHub上创建文件夹。以下是简单的步骤:
- 进入项目库:登录您的GitHub账户,进入需要创建文件夹的项目库。
- 点击“Add file”:在页面右上角找到“Add file”按钮。
- 选择“Create new file”:选择“Create new file”选项。
- 输入文件夹名称:在文件名框中输入文件夹名称,后跟一个斜杠(/),例如:
my_folder/
。 - 添加文件:在新文件夹中添加文件,最后提交更改。
分享文件夹的步骤
一旦创建了文件夹,您就可以通过以下步骤进行分享:
- 设置项目为公开或私人:选择合适的权限设置。
- 公共项目:任何人都可以访问。
- 私有项目:只有授权用户可以访问。
- 生成链接:在项目页面上,复制URL链接。
- 分享链接:将链接发送给其他用户或团队成员。
使用GitHub Pages分享文件夹
如果您想要创建一个网站来分享您的文件夹内容,可以使用GitHub Pages:
- 启用GitHub Pages:在项目设置中找到GitHub Pages选项并启用。
- 选择分支:选择您希望用于GitHub Pages的分支。
- 创建网页文件:在您的文件夹中创建
index.html
文件,以便展示内容。 - 访问页面:使用生成的GitHub Pages链接来访问您分享的文件夹。
分享文件夹时的最佳实践
在GitHub上分享文件夹时,考虑以下最佳实践将有助于提升用户体验和项目可维护性:
- 保持结构清晰:确保文件夹结构简洁明了,便于其他人导航。
- 添加文档:为文件夹中的代码或资源添加文档,以解释使用方法和功能。
- 使用标签:在代码中添加清晰的标签,帮助他人理解每个部分的功能。
- 定期更新:确保项目定期更新,以修复bug和添加新功能。
常见问题解答
如何分享GitHub上的私人文件夹?
要分享私人文件夹,您需要将特定用户添加为合作者。进入项目设置,找到“Collaborators”选项,输入用户的GitHub用户名并发送邀请。
可以直接分享文件夹链接吗?
是的,您可以直接分享特定文件夹的链接,例如:https://github.com/用户名/项目名/tree/分支名/文件夹名
。
在GitHub上分享文件夹的限制是什么?
分享文件夹时,您必须遵循GitHub的服务条款,确保不侵犯他人的版权和隐私。
如何将GitHub文件夹分享给没有GitHub账户的人?
您可以分享项目的公共链接,任何人都可以访问。若项目为私有,则需要有GitHub账户并被授予访问权限。
如何删除GitHub上的文件夹?
要删除文件夹,进入文件夹页面,选择“Delete this file”,然后在项目设置中提交更改。
结语
通过上述方法,您可以轻松地在GitHub上分享文件夹,帮助其他开发者更好地使用和贡献代码。遵循最佳实践和规范的管理,将有助于提高您的项目质量和协作效率。希望本文对您有所帮助,祝您在GitHub上顺利分享文件夹!